Hi I've bought a few weaners to run on some rough ground. I'm new to pigs I'm feeding them pellets. How much kg per head a day. Any other feeds to keep costs down. Thanks
Waste potatoes waste turnips and sugar beet things like that if you know anyone you could buy bulk of only way keep costs down or if you could get out of date bread be great
Commercially, the best way to keep costs down is to get them to grow fast, so feed the best grub ad lib.
If you haven’t got modern genetics they won’t cope with that regime and will get too fat.
Brewers wort could be a try. We've always had this for free in the past from small breweries, but I gather in other parts of the country you may need to pay for it.
